Technical Considerations and Crafters' Notes

While this asset is high-quality, responsible handmade sellers know that testing before selling finished products is non-negotiable. Here are some practical notes based on my workflow with Roses Flowers Line Art Vintage:

  1. Check Line Weight: While the lines are generally clean, be cautious with very small cutting details. If you plan to make tiny stickers, test the resolution to ensure the thin lines don't break during weeding or application.
  2. Layered Vinyl Projects: For multi-color designs, ensure the layers separate correctly in your software. The simplicity of the line art makes it easier to layer than complex illustrations, but always preview the transparency of the PNG files to avoid background issues.
  3. Color Contrast: Since this is primarily line art, it works best on light-colored substrates. If you intend to use it on dark products, consider adding a white backing or ensuring the color contrast is sufficient for visibility.
  4. Font Pairing: To complete the vintage look, pair these illustrations with script fonts for a romantic feel or serif fonts for a classic editorial style. Avoid overly modern sans-serif fonts unless you are aiming for a specific retro-modern contrast.
  5. Licensing Verification: Before using any design asset for customer orders or commercial design purposes, confirm the commercial license. Most marketplaces offer broad rights, but double-checking protects your small business from legal issues.

I also recommend resizing the design for different products. A large version might look stunning on a wall art print, while a scaled-down version works better as a subtle detail on a jewelry box. Simplifying the layout if needed can help when the design becomes too crowded on smaller items like bottle caps or keychains.
